Troubleshooting DHCP Relay Agent Configuration
Symptom
A client fails to obtain configuration information through a DHCP relay agent.
Analysis
This problem may be caused by improper DHCP relay agent configuration. When a DHCP relay agent
operates improperly, you can locate the problem by enabling debugging and checking the information
about debugging and interface state (You can display the information by executing the corresponding
display command.)
Solution
z
Check if an address pool that is on the same network segment with the DHCP clients is configured
on the DHCP server.
z
Check if a reachable route is configured between the DHCP relay agent and the DHCP server.
z
Check the DHCP relay agent. Check if the correct DHCP server group is configured on the
interface connecting the network segment where the DHCP client resides. Check if the IP address
of the DHCP server group is correct.
z
If the
address-check enable
command is configured on the interface connected to the DHCP
server, verify the DHCP server’s IP-to-MAC address binding entry is configured on the DHCP relay
agent; otherwise the DHCP client cannot obtain an IP address.
